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1. Roman diagnostic criteria for functional constipation IV; TCM syndrome differentiation belongs to qi stagnation; 2. Aged >=18 and <= 65 years old; No gender restriction; 3. Did not take any laxative medicine (such as Dumicol and MAREN soft capsule) for at least one week before enrollment; 4. Understand and agree to participate in this study and sign the informed consent;

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1. Severe damage to heart, brain, liver, kidney and other important organs; 2. Pregnancy or lactation; 3. Colorectal organic lesions were confirmed by examination; 4. Those with irritable bowel syndrome and those with abdominal surgery history; 5. A clear history of anxiety,depression and constipation caused by long-term use of psychiatric drugs.
